Assessing Lawyer Experience
When choosing a criminal defense attorney, analyzing their experience is crucial. You'll want to dive deep right into their past instances to understand not just the amount of situations they've managed, yet the quality of end results attained.
It's not practically how long they've been exercising, however exactly how well they've dealt with situations comparable to yours. Seek specifics: Have they handled costs like your own prior to? The number of of those instances went to trial, and what were the results?
It's crucial you recognize they have actually got a solid performance history with effective results in circumstances akin to what you're facing. Experience in a courtroom is particularly indispensable if your case goes to test. You don't just want a person that understands the regulation; you need somebody that maneuvers properly within the courtroom characteristics.
Furthermore, check where they have actually gained their experience. Someone who knows with the neighborhood courts and courts can be helpful. They'll understand neighborhood procedures and nuances which can play a critical function in the protection strategy.
Selecting somebody seasoned can make all the difference. Ensure their experience aligns closely with your needs, providing you the very best shot at a positive end result.
Evaluating Interaction Abilities
Examining interaction abilities is important when selecting a criminal defense lawyer. You'll want a person that not just talks clearly yet also listens efficiently. Your lawyer must make you feel comprehended and ensure that you comprehend every facet of your situation.
Look for a legal representative that can clarify complex legal terms in uncomplicated language. They need to be approachable, making it simple for you to ask inquiries and reveal worries. Notification just how they interact during your first examination. Are they patient? Do they provide thorough answers or thrill with descriptions?
Great interaction additionally suggests staying in contact. Your lawyer needs to update you on a regular basis about your situation's progress. Check if they choose emails, phone calls, or face-to-face conferences and see if their favored approach straightens with your needs.
Finally, consider their capability to communicate under pressure. Courtroom setups are high-stress atmospheres, and you require someone who can express your protection clearly and well in front of a judge and jury.
Ask for instances of exactly how they have actually dealt with challenging cases or situations in the past.
Recognizing Defense Methods
Comprehending the various protection techniques your lawyer may use is critical to successfully navigating your instance. Each strategy depends upon the specifics of the fees you're dealing with and the evidence against you. Let's delve into what you need to know.
First of all, if there's a lack of proof, your lawyer might say that the prosecution hasn't satisfied its burden of proof. Remember, it's not your work to verify innocence; it's the prosecutor's job to prove regret beyond a practical uncertainty. If they can't, you need to be acquitted.
An additional usual strategy is self-defense, especially in cases including fees like assault or murder. If you were safeguarding yourself, your lawyer could use this technique to validate your actions legally. This requires showing that your understanding of threat was reasonable and that your response was proportional to that danger.
In some cases, your defense may involve questioning the legality of just how evidence was obtained. If police breached your civil liberties throughout the examination, evidence might be suppressed, which can dramatically weaken the prosecution's instance.
Lastly, your attorney may bargain a plea offer if it offers your best interest. This usually happens if the proof versus you is strong but there are reducing factors that can lead to minimized fees or sentencing.
Comprehending these methods assists you review your case more effectively with your attorney.
